The first thing I like about Johnson is that he just seems very smooth on film. He has a great pair of hands and while his athleticism isn't off the charts, he just seems very solid. He can make catches over the top, he can make them in the middle of the field in traffic, he just does a lot of things well.
He reminds me of Kevin Norwood from Alabama a few years ago. Just a very solid playmaker in the midst of a nice receiving corps. Johnson should be able to provide Tennessee with more depth at the wide receiver position and with a good work ethic it's easy to see him meshing with wide receivers coach Zach Azzanni.
Johnson also adds another receiver that's around 6-foot-2, as the Vols continue to get taller and bigger at that position. (Read Brent's story about that here.)
With Jauan Jennings, Preston Williams, Josh Malone and Jeff George all expected around several more years, it's another strong pickup that fits a need for Tennessee.
